About

Redcliffe ward is located in the Royal Borough of Kensington and Chelsea, covering an area south of Earl’s Court and north of Fulham Road. The ward is primarily residential, with a mix of Victorian and Edwardian terraced houses, along with some modern apartment buildings. Its streets are lined with trees, and several small green spaces provide pockets of greenery. The area is well-connected, with Earl’s Court and West Brompton stations nearby, offering access to the District and Piccadilly lines.

Local amenities include independent shops, cafes, and pubs, particularly along Redcliffe Gardens and Fulham Road. The ward is also home to the Redcliffe School, a primary school serving the community. While quieter than some neighboring areas, it retains a sense of urban convenience, with supermarkets and pharmacies within easy reach. The proximity to larger hubs like Earl’s Court and Chelsea adds to its appeal for residents seeking a balance between tranquility and accessibility.

Area overview

On average Redcliffe has moderate deprivation and moderate crime levels, with around 102 crimes per 1,000 residents per year. Approximately 11.1% of homes in this area are social housing provided by a local council or housing association. The average income of residents in Redcliffe is £80,422 per year. There are 2 schools in Redcliffe: 2 primary (1 Outstanding and 1 Good) and 0 secondary (0 Outstanding and 0 Good). On average most houses in area has good public transport connectivity.

Property prices in Redcliffe

Based on 101 recent sales, the median property price is £1,005,000 in Redcliffe area, with individual transactions ranging from £150,000 up to £18,700,000.
